Re: Changing Xterm's Configuration



 --- John Lowell <johnlowell@ameritech.net> wrote: 

> creating and editing an ~/.Xdefaults, my xterminal seems impervious to  
> positive alteration. I can change -fg to black from white after having  
> selected -bg gray, for example, and nothing at all happens. What am I  
> missing here?

You probably didn't run:

xrdb -merge ~/.Xdefaults 

After you edited ~/.Xdefaults.  Indeed there are external programs to
change how Xterm works:

xtermset
xtermcontrol

are two such programs -- but enabling options in ~/.Xdefaults ought to do
it, assuming you remerge the Xdefaults database back in....
